Matt Johnson, Lead Pastor

Matt grew up in Iowa, but has spent most of his adult life in the Chicagoland area.  He received a B.A. in Film from Full Sail University in 2006, after which he worked for and volunteered in several churches in the Des Moines area while contemplating his calling. He and his wife Jessica met during that time and were married on June 11, 2011. A year after their marriage, they moved to Chicago for Matt to attend Moody Theological Seminary and Jess taught art in the inner city. Matt graduated from Moody Theological Seminary with a Master of Divinity in 2015. Matt loves storytelling and seeing lives changed through effective communication of the Bible, and is currently working on a Doctorate in Practical Theology focused on helping people better understand God’s Word. Matt and Jess have two children, Lucy and Levi. As a family, the Johnson’s love exploring new playgrounds, cooking food, playing Frisbee, and reading books.

Our Elders

“Keep watch over yourselves and all the flock of which the Holy Spirit has made you overseers. Be shepherds of the church of God, which he bought with his own blood” Acts 20:28

The Elders of Cornerstone Church shepherd the flock by guarding, feeding, and overseeing those who have been entrusted to them.

 Our Deacons

 “For those who serve well as deacons gain a good standing for themselves and also great confidence in the faith that is in Christ Jesus.” – 1 Timothy 3:13

The Deacons of Cornerstone serve our congregation by caring for the many physical and financial needs of our buildings and grounds.

Our Deaconesses

“I commend to you our sister Phoebe, a servant of the church at Cenchreae, that you may welcome her in the Lord in a way worthy of the saints, and help her in whatever she may need from you, for she has been a patron of many and of myself as well.” – Romans 16:1-2

The deaconesses of Cornerstone serve the body in a variety of ways including CARE ministry and special events. They also keep areas of our church clean and tidy, prepare the elements for the Lord’s Supper.
